Vue.js简介_简介_相关问答FAQs Vue用于构建交互式的用户界面
Vue.js简介
Vue.js是一个用于构建用户界面的JavaScript框架,简单来说,就是可以帮助我们更轻松地开发网页和应用。
Vue.js的主要用途
一、构建单页面应用(SPA)
SPA就是那种打开一个网页后,里面的内容可以随时更新,就像玩游戏一样,不用重新加载整个页面。Vue.js在这方面特别强,因为它可以让页面更新得超级快,用户体验超好,而且代码也好维护。
优势 | 描述 |
---|---|
快速响应 | 无需重新加载页面,操作响应更快。 |
良好用户体验 | 动态更新内容,页面流畅,加载时间短。 |
易于维护 | 组件化结构,代码易于维护和扩展。 |
二、组件化开发
Vue.js让开发者可以把应用拆分成多个小模块,每个模块就是一个组件,负责一部分功能。这样代码就不容易重复,而且好管理。
- 可重用性:组件可以重复使用,提高效率。
- 模块化:代码结构清晰,方便管理。
- 独立性:组件可以独立开发,提高质量。
三、数据绑定和双向数据绑定
Vue.js有一个很酷的功能,就是数据绑定。比如,你可以在一个输入框里输入内容,然后这个内容就会自动显示在页面上。双向绑定就更神奇了,输入框里的内容变了,页面上显示的内容也会变,反之亦然。
比如这样:
```html{{ message }}
```四、响应式设计和状态管理
Vue.js可以自动更新页面,当数据发生变化时,页面上的内容也会跟着变。对于大项目,Vue.js还提供了一个叫做Vuex的工具,可以帮助我们管理应用的状态,让不同组件之间的状态保持一致。
五、其他用途和优势
除了以上功能,Vue.js还有很多优势,比如它是渐进式框架,可以逐步引入,不需要一次性重构整个应用;它有一个丰富的生态系统,有很多有用的工具;而且它容易学习,新手也能快速上手。
Vue.js是一个强大的框架,适合构建各种类型的应用。为了更好地使用Vue.js,建议开发者先学习基础知识,然后通过实践项目来提高技能,还要学习生态系统中的工具,并关注社区动态。
相关问答FAQs
- Vue用于构建交互式的用户界面。 Vue通过模板语法、数据绑定和组件化,让开发者能够轻松构建交互式界面。
- Vue用于创建可复用的组件。 Vue的组件化思想让开发者可以将页面拆分成可复用的组件,提高开发效率。
- Vue用于构建响应式的应用程序。 Vue通过双向数据绑定和虚拟DOM,让开发者能够构建响应式应用程序。